Binary Search

The pre-requisite of the binary search algorithm is sorted data. The algorithm iteratively divides a list into two parts and keeps a track of the lowest and highest indices until it finds the value it is looking for:

def BinarySearch(list, item):    first = 0    last = len(list)-1    found = False while first<=last and not found:             midpoint = (first + last)//2             if list[midpoint] == item:                     found = True             else:                     if item < list[midpoint]:                             last = midpoint-1                     else:                             first = midpoint+1     return found

The output is as follows:

Note that calling the BinarySearch function will return True if the value is found in the input list.
